Event Summary

The National Weather Service office MKX issued a tornado warning at 00:46 UTC on Apr 18, 2026. The warning was in effect for 59 minutes, ending at Apr 18, 2026 01:45 UTC. At the last radar check, the storm was located near 42.82, -88.13, moving east at about 31 mph.

Storm Reports

TimeLocationCounty / StateEFRemarks
2 N Wind Lake Waukesha, WI UNK NWS Damage Survey concludes an EF-0 tornado occurred with estimated peak winds of 70 mph and a width of 75 yards. The tornado started near the intersection of Kelsey Dr (MKX)
5 ESE Wind Lake Racine, WI UNK NWS Damage Survey reported EF-0 Tornado... estimated peak winds of 80 mph. Began on west side of US-45 in northern Racine Co near North Cape and tracked northeast to 7 (MKX)
4 E Wind Lake Racine, WI UNK NWS Damage Survey reported EF-1 Tornado... estimated peak winds of 100 mph. Began on west side of US-45 in northern Racine Co and tracked northeast to County Line Rd on (MKX)

Preliminary local storm reports (SPC) within the warned area window — subject to revision after NWS surveys.
